首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用dplyr根据向量中存在的字符串进行变异和赋值

dplyr是一个在R语言中用于数据处理和操作的强大包。它提供了一组简洁且一致的函数,可以轻松地对数据进行筛选、排序、汇总和变异等操作。

要根据向量中存在的字符串进行变异和赋值,可以使用dplyr中的mutate()函数和if_else()函数。下面是一个示例代码:

代码语言:txt
复制
library(dplyr)

# 创建一个包含字符串的向量
my_vector <- c("apple", "banana", "orange", "grape")

# 使用mutate()函数和if_else()函数进行变异和赋值
result <- my_vector %>%
  mutate(new_value = if_else(my_vector %in% c("apple", "orange"), "fruit", "unknown"))

# 输出结果
print(result)

在上面的代码中,首先创建了一个包含字符串的向量my_vector。然后使用mutate()函数和if_else()函数对向量进行变异和赋值。if_else()函数的第一个参数是一个逻辑条件,判断向量中的元素是否存在于指定的字符串集合中。如果存在,则将新值设置为"fruit",否则设置为"unknown"。最后,使用print()函数输出结果。

这个例子展示了如何使用dplyr根据向量中存在的字符串进行变异和赋值。在实际应用中,你可以根据具体的需求和条件进行相应的操作。

腾讯云相关产品和产品介绍链接地址:

以上是腾讯云提供的一些相关产品,可以根据具体需求选择适合的产品来支持云计算和相关领域的开发工作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券